SNP MP Cherry calls for UK Government to close the borders

- By GINA DAVIDSON

Joanna Cherry has said the UK Government must introduce urgent health measures for people travelling to and from Britain to prevent internatio­nal transmissi­on of Covid-19 and its new strains, including closing borders to all but essential travel.

She claimed Home S ecre - tary Priti Patel was “repeating the same mistakes we've seen the UK Government make throughout this crisis” by failing to restrict internatio­nal travel or introduce a rigorous system of health checks and quarantini­ng.

The Edinburgh South West MP also said the Home Office must bring the UK “into line with other countries” where tighter measures are being placed on travel.

Her comments came just hours after First Minister Nicola Sturgeon said internatio­nal travel was “effectivel­y banned” in the new lockdown.

She also said she had discussed the prospect of new border controls with UK leaders.

“It is deeply concerning that the Home Secretary is repeating the same mistakes we've seen the UK Government make throughout this crisis by failing to introduce effective restrictio­ns and health measures at the UK border to prevent the transmissi­on of Covid-19 and its new strains,” she said.

“The UK Government was far too slow to act in the spring, allowing hundreds of thousands of internatio­nal visitors to enter the country in the middle of a global pandemic without effective measures in place.

"It seems as though they haven't learnt a thing."
